What companies run services between Gunnersbury Station, England and Russell Square Underground Station, England?

You can take a subway from Gunnersbury station to Russell Square station via Hammersmith in around 33 min. Alternatively, Metroline Travel operates a bus from Gunnersbury Station to Aldwych / Drury Lane hourly. Tickets cost £2 and the journey takes 41 min.
